monkeyman Hochseilgarten – No-Limit GmbH

264 Reviews
Allerpark 6, 38448 Wolfsburg
Outdoor playgroundKiosk

“The monkeyman high ropes course in Wolfsburg offers an exciting climbing experience for children aged 8 and above, with a minimum height of 1.40 m. With five creative routes ranging from 6 to 13 meters high and a low ropes course for younger children, there is something for everyone. The friendly team ensures safety through double safety measures, and the relaxed atmosphere in the wooded surroundings makes the visit a special experience. Additionally, there is a playground and a kiosk for snacks and refreshments.”

HYGIA X-Perience Park (Kidsworld)

327 Reviews
Allerpark 1, 38448 Wolfsburg
Indoor play area

“The HYGIA X-Perience Park (Kidsworld) in Wolfsburg is a child-friendly indoor play park that offers a variety of play options, including bouncy castles, trampolines, and climbing structures. The facility is well air-conditioned and has a separate area for toddlers to ensure safety. Although there are some defective balls in the ball pit and fresh air is sometimes lacking, the children have a lot of fun. The entrance fee is reasonable at €7 for children aged 4 and up and €3 for accompanying adults, and there is plenty of free parking available.”
